Transaction 3aef7169841fdb1c163edf29ef7c3be28e2a56e8675d2b9f42679074127baa46
1 Input
2 Outputs
- 3aef7169841fdb1c163edf29ef7c3be28e2a56e8675d2b9f42679074127baa46:0
- 3aef7169841fdb1c163edf29ef7c3be28e2a56e8675d2b9f42679074127baa46:1
value 747682
address 14aZEUXsxKz6JfEYwf7PFsTVELftTPGoVv
value 2425655
address 1E9UMGaNsisAUDTPpT1Du4oS4rF7fwcu3z